Sick track man, really like the kind of dissonant sound going on with the vocals and the overall mixing. I do feel like you could change the arrangement possibly as around 2 min the repetetiveness of the drums starts to wear for me, so like when that piano comes in you could take away the drums even and build back into the drums with a slightly more complex pattern or slight addition of sounds something to change it up. Later on I felt like some of the vocals could be more forward in the mix, but it still works well for sure, so you could add another layer of vocals over the top somewhere in the track too to layer it up so you have more to build to in the track and then when you take away bits there's layers to what could be left, as the track is 4 mins ish it's hard to hold people for that long unless the arrangement etc is a bit different or there's vocals/rap.

The keys are a bit bright in my opinion and they sound like a vst they don't sound realistic. Try using a bit of eq and varying volume and take them off the grid a bit. The 808 is nice but it is clashing with the low end of the vocal sample when it first comes in with the keys in the beginning. This is a really dope idea just needs a little bit of improvement in the mix.
